1. Wearable Technology: The Power of Data
In the world of football, precision is everything. Whether it's the number of sprints a player makes or how far they run during a match, knowing the minute details can make a huge difference in both training and performance. Wearable technology, such as GPS trackers, heart rate monitors, and smart shirts, has given coaches and players a treasure trove of data to work with.
GPS trackers are perhaps the most widely used wearable technology in modern football. These small devices are worn by players during training and matches, collecting data on everything from distance covered to top speed. Coaches can use this information to analyse a player’s stamina, positioning, and work rate during a game. For example, if a midfielder is running significantly more than others, it might indicate that they are covering gaps or are overly involved in the game. This data allows coaches to adjust tactics or training loads accordingly, optimising player performance.
Heart rate monitors help measure a player’s cardiovascular response to exercise, allowing coaches to monitor recovery times, intensity, and fitness levels. This information is vital for ensuring players don’t over-exert themselves and are prepared for match conditions. It also allows players to fine-tune their physical condition, pushing their limits while remaining in peak health.
The key benefit of wearable technology is that it empowers both coaches and players with real-time insights into performance. This feedback loop accelerates improvement, allowing players to make adjustments immediately rather than waiting for post-match analysis.
2. Video Analysis: Breaking Down the Game
Football is a game of split-second decisions. What happens in the heat of the moment often defines the outcome. Video analysis tools now allow coaches and players to break down every aspect of a game, from player positioning to tactical execution, and learn from those moments.
Video analysis software such as Hudl, Wyscout, or Veo provides coaches with the ability to study match footage in intricate detail. Coaches can isolate inpidual player movements, evaluate passing sequences, and even analyse how players react to certain situations. This allows players to understand their strengths and weaknesses and to see first-hand how they fit into the team’s tactical setup.
For example, a forward might use video analysis to study how their positioning impacts the team’s attacking flow, while a defender could assess their positioning during set pieces or tackles. Video technology is also an excellent tool for reviewing opposition teams, helping to identify weaknesses or trends that can be exploited.
Moreover, these tools enable coaches to provide players with a more personalised coaching experience. Instead of simply telling a player what to improve, coaches can show them with clear, visual evidence. This approach not only enhances learning but also boosts a player's ability to adapt quickly in high-pressure situations.
3. Virtual Reality (VR): Training the Mind and Body
While physical conditioning and tactical understanding are essential, mental sharpness is equally critical in football. Players need to be prepared for anything—whether it’s managing the pressure of a penalty shootout or making the right pass in the dying moments of a match. Enter Virtual Reality (VR), a technology that is beginning to revolutionise mental and tactical training.
VR systems like those from companies such as STRIVR or Rezzil offer a unique way for players to simulate match scenarios without the physical strain. Using a VR headset, players can virtually experience game situations, ranging from penalty kicks to understanding defensive positioning. This immersive experience allows players to mentally rehearse scenarios, helping them develop quicker decision-making abilities, better anticipation, and greater focus.
For instance, a goalkeeper can use VR to train for penalty shots, replicating various in-game scenarios without having to wait for a match. A midfielder can practice passing and vision, while attackers can improve their movement and finishing under pressure. VR is an excellent tool for mental preparation, as it allows players to train under simulated match conditions, which helps reduce anxiety and improve performance in real-life situations.
4. Data Analytics: The Future of Football Strategy
The rise of data analytics in football has also had a profound impact on player development and team strategy. Rather than relying purely on intuition and experience, modern football teams are now using sophisticated algorithms and statistical models to inform their decisions.
From player recruitment to match preparation, data analytics is helping clubs make smarter, more informed choices. In player development, analytics can identify a player’s strengths and areas for improvement by tracking metrics such as pass completion rates, tackles, and shooting accuracy. By monitoring these numbers over time, coaches can better understand a player’s trajectory and tailor their training accordingly.
Additionally, predictive analytics can be used to assess the likelihood of injury based on a player’s workload, age, and previous injuries. This allows clubs to minimise the risk of burnout and injury by adjusting training loads and recovery periods, ensuring players remain at their peak throughout the season.
